The Global Wearable Patches Market is projected to grow from USD 891.02 Million in 2025 to USD 1279.75 Million by 2031 at a 6.22% CAGR. These non-invasive, skin-adhesive devices are engineered to seamlessly deliver therapies or constantly track physiological metrics. Market growth is largely fueled by the rising worldwide incidence of chronic conditions that require continuous observation, alongside a shift toward remote monitoring tools that improve both clinical workflows and patient comfort. Progress in secure wireless communications and miniaturized sensors further accelerates this expansion. Highlighting the rapid adoption of connected healthcare, CHIME's 2024 Most Wired survey reports that 87% of healthcare organizations now incorporate remote patient monitoring into their care strategies.

Despite this positive trajectory, a major hurdle restricting market growth is the intricate and constantly changing regulatory environment across various global regions. The lack of unified standards for medical device approvals, especially concerning innovative digital health tools, acts as a significant obstacle. This regulatory fragmentation can stall new product introductions and drive up compliance expenses for developers.

Market Driver

Innovations in sensor miniaturization and enhanced functionality are significantly propelling the Global Wearable Patches Market forward. By integrating smaller yet highly capable sensors into flexible designs, manufacturers provide a less intrusive and highly comfortable experience that encourages patient adherence to continuous monitoring. These improvements also bring multi-parameter sensing to a single patch, allowing simultaneous tracking of various physiological metrics like temperature, respiratory rate, heart rate, and specific biomarkers. Illustrating this progress, Medtronic announced in May 2025 the European expansion of its portfolio with the Corsano multi-parameter wearable, a medically certified device that continuously tracks vital signs including ECG, cuffless blood pressure, SpO2, breathing, and heart rate. Packing multiple functions into such a small device shifts wearable patches from simple tracking tools to advanced therapeutic and diagnostic instruments.

The escalating global rate of chronic illnesses acts as another primary catalyst for market expansion. Medical conditions like chronic respiratory issues, cardiovascular diseases, and diabetes require continuous observation to properly manage the disease and avoid severe complications. Wearable patches provide an ongoing, non-invasive way for individuals to monitor essential health data away from clinical environments, thereby enhancing their overall quality of life through proactive management. Highlighting the scale of this need, the International Diabetes Federation's 2025 11th edition Diabetes Atlas indicates that roughly 589 million adults between 20 and 79 years old are affected by diabetes worldwide. The surging reliance on connected health devices further validates this need for accessible monitoring tools, as demonstrated by Abbott's January 2026 financial report, which noted a $2.0 billion fourth-quarter sales figure for their continuous glucose monitors, a primary wearable patch category.

Market Challenge

The shifting and complicated regulatory frameworks found across different global jurisdictions pose a major obstacle to the growth of the Global Wearable Patches Market. Because there is a lack of unified criteria for approving medical devices, especially concerning the new digital health features integrated into these patches, developers face severe difficulties. Dealing with disjointed regulations requires exhaustive and frequently overlapping compliance efforts, which ultimately drives up operating expenses and extends the timeline for product development.

Such regulatory hurdles heavily impact where companies choose to debut their wearable patch innovations. A 2025 MedTech Europe survey revealed that large medical device producers reduced their preference for the European Union as a primary launch market by roughly 33% after the strict enforcement of the In Vitro Diagnostic Regulation and Medical Device Regulation. This statistic underscores the extent to which intricate compliance rules can postpone the rollout of modern healthcare products, limit the international reach of wearable patches, and ultimately stifle the broader market's expansion.

Market Trends

A prominent shift in the industry involves the smooth incorporation of wearable patches into wider mobile and digital health networks, redefining the collection, sharing, and application of patient information. This development allows physiological data recorded by the patches to sync instantly with telehealth systems, electronic health records (EHRs), and smartphone apps. By offering a complete picture of an individual's well-being, this connectivity enables both patients and medical professionals to make well-informed health choices from a distance. As noted in a January 2026 corporate update from Epic Systems, more than 300 healthcare groups using their software have successfully merged information from consumer health devices, such as wearable patches, into their medical processes to boost remote monitoring effectiveness and proactive treatment.

Additionally, the market is experiencing a strong push toward utilizing AI-powered predictive analytics to analyze the uninterrupted flow of data from wearable patches, helping to spot minor health anomalies and anticipate medical events. Healthcare professionals can use machine learning models on this constant stream of physiological information to move away from reactive responses toward preventative care, thereby avoiding negative health consequences. Converting raw sensor metrics into practical guidance allows for the early detection of infections or the prediction of chronic disease flare-ups. AstraZeneca emphasized this movement during their January 2026 presentation at the J.P. Morgan Healthcare Conference, highlighting that their research and development approach heavily incorporates AI strategies to optimize drug creation, further cementing wearable patches as sophisticated instruments for smart healthcare management.
